Winnipeg driver charged with assaulting passenger

WINNIPEG, Manitoba — A Winnipeg Transit driver is facing an assault charge after a woman complained she had been pushed and beaten by the driver on a Saturday morning route, according to a Winnipeg Free Press report.

Police said after cautioning the woman for putting her feet up on a seat and for falling asleep, a physical altercation ensued when it is alleged the driver tried to remove her from the bus. For the full story, click here.
